Output 5c39c6a517849fa96ede54f631727cb5f1af8c33a40641e8eba000081631f851:1

value
5701349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f738c1b9739d49c4e2ea4d43325a77c6b4917a OP_EQUAL
address
3DSvaN2TNsmJKCpZd5spndHM7Usgu58CsL
transaction
5c39c6a517849fa96ede54f631727cb5f1af8c33a40641e8eba000081631f851
spent
true